Course Content

• STEM Funding Landscape & Grant Writing
• Identifying & Securing STEM Grants & Scholarships
• Proposal Development & Budget Management for STEM Projects
• Navigating the Federal STEM Funding Process (NIH, NSF, etc.)
• Data Analysis & Visualization for STEM Grant Reporting
• Intellectual Property Management in STEM Research
• Ethical Considerations in STEM Research & Funding
• STEM Funding Opportunities for Women & Underrepresented Minorities

Many funding opportunities exist to support individuals pursuing these valuable credentials. These programs often focus on developing in-demand skills for high-growth industries.


Learning outcomes for these certificates vary depending on the specific program, but typically include enhanced technical proficiency, improved problem-solving abilities, and a deeper understanding of relevant STEM concepts. Many programs integrate hands-on projects and real-world case studies, maximizing industry relevance.


Duration of these programs is flexible, ranging from a few months to a year or more, catering to various learning styles and schedules. Some offer accelerated tracks, while others allow for more self-paced learning. This flexibility is a key factor when considering funding options and personal commitments.


The industry relevance of a Professional Certificate in STEM is undeniable. Graduates often find employment in fields such as data science, engineering, cybersecurity, and biotechnology, all experiencing significant growth and demand for skilled professionals. This high demand often translates into competitive salaries and excellent career advancement opportunities.


Funding opportunities for Professional Certificate in STEM programs can include scholarships, grants, employer-sponsored tuition assistance, and government-backed loan programs.
